Answer to Monday's question: John Reid and Robby Robinson are the coaches in addition to Jeff Herron who this season led their second schools into the semifinals. Reid has taken 2016 Rome and 2006 East Paulding to the semifinals. Robinson has taken 2016 McIntosh County Academy and 2002 Metter to the semifinals. Herron has taken four schools - Oconee County, Camden County, Prince Avenue Christian and now Grayson.
